Transaction 04454ca159f8745497c457a784b74a756292e11055e78965d934fdc6498d0367
1 Input
2 Outputs
- 04454ca159f8745497c457a784b74a756292e11055e78965d934fdc6498d0367:0
- 04454ca159f8745497c457a784b74a756292e11055e78965d934fdc6498d0367:1
value 529990000
address 1FJvHAeW7ZA615MT3YgGk5HfSCtDNL9jYs
value 23032247871
address 15cjywizbiiUWRMrDrUzAUQnGpwHJ2m2Pb